Some damage is easy to shrug off. Small scratches in the clear coat usually pose no immediate risk; they may just affect your pride more than your car's performance. However, dents along body lines, deep gouges exposing bare metal, or anything affecting doors and hoods can invite rust and weaken structural integrity.
A client once brought in a late-model SUV with what looked like a minor dent near the rear wheel well. Upon closer inspection, we found that the impact had misaligned the wheel arch trim and shifted part of the suspension mounting. What appeared superficial could have created real safety issues down the line.

If your vehicle features driver assistance systems - think lane-keeping sensors or adaptive cruise control - even slight bumps can knock sensors out of calibration. At our collision repair shop, we see cars come in after fender benders needing not only paintwork but also ADAS calibration services to ensure all safety features work as intended.
Leaving small dents and dings untreated might seem thrifty at first glance. However, New Hampshire’s weather brings moisture and salt into every crevice of local car mechanical repairs exposed metal. A thumb-sized chip today can become a rusted-out panel within a year if left open to the elements.

Insurance adjusters also pay close attention to prior damage during claims assessments. If you delay necessary collision repair after an accident, you risk complications with coverage later on.
It helps to know which issues remain purely cosmetic and which require urgent attention from an auto body shop:
| Type | Cosmetic Only | Needs Immediate Repair | |----------------------|----------------------------------------|------------------------------------| | Scratches | Surface-level marks | Deep cuts through paint/primer | | Dents | Small dings away from seams/edges | On doors/hoods/trunk seams | | Paint chips | Tiny stone chips | Chipped areas showing bare metal | | Bumper damage | Light scuffs | Cracks affecting mounting points |

Modern cars often blur the line between bodywork and mechanical repairs. After even low-speed impacts, components like radiators, air conditioning condensers, or engine mounts may need inspection by technicians trained in both disciplines.
A case that stands out involved a sedan whose rear-end impact seemed limited to the bumper cover at first glance. Our team discovered that hidden beneath was damage to wiring harnesses belonging to rear sensors - invisible unless panels were removed for closer inspection.
North Hampton’s coastal climate presents unique challenges: salty air accelerates corrosion while sand from winter roads finds its way into every nook of damaged panels. Shops familiar with these conditions know how best to prep surfaces before repainting and how to advise on rust prevention measures specific to this region.
